Full Description
(ST759179 DMV sited to Gomershay Farm from OS 10000 1983) <1>
The 'lost' hamlet of Gomershay is described by Hutchins as being West of Stalbridge, whilst Issac Taylor shows 'Gummersey' East of Stalbridge and 'Gomershay' to its South. <2>
Recorded in the Dorset Feet of Fire, 1315 as 'Gommereshaye'. <3>

'(28) Cultivation remains. The open fields of Stalbridge lay S. and E. of the town and were probably still in existence in 1516, when a 'South Field' was recorded (Dorset Procs., LXXVII (1955), 161). Ridge-and-furrow can be seen on air photographs (R.A.F. CPE/UK 1974: 3157) N.E. of Sturt Farm (730170); it is unrelated to the present field boundaries.
The open fields of Stalbridge Weston were already enclosed in 1662 (Schedule of Land at Stalbridge Weston, D.C.R.O.). Ridge-and-furrow within existing fields, associated with the settlements of Hargrove, Marsh and Gummershay farms, is noted at 750154, 755165 and 757178; it is 6 yds. To 7 yds. wide with headlands 7 yds. wide'.
